Updates get lost between the cabin and the office. The site and the office disagree on status. The drawing the foreman is using turns out to be revision two when the office is on revision four. A variation gets done, never gets signed, never gets paid. None of it shows up on a Gantt chart.

§ 03NEC and JCT

The clauses.
With the cadence.

We have stood in too many post-mortems where a perfectly good NEC4 contract lost the firm tens of thousands because a notice missed the window. The platform watches the clock and tells you when each notice is due, with the form already filled in.

// Form 01

NEC4

  • Early warning notices · auto-cadence
  • Compensation events · 8-week clock
  • Programme submission · monthly
  • Pay notice · 7 days from assessment
  • Pay-less notice · 7 days before final
  • Defects certificate · standard form
// Form 02

NEC3

  • Early warning · risk register
  • Compensation events · 7-week clock
  • Risk reduction meetings
  • Activity schedule updates
  • Programme · clause 31 / 32
  • Defects · clause 43
// Form 03

JCT

  • Variations · architect's instructions
  • Loss & expense claims
  • Interim valuations · monthly
  • Pay notice · 5 days
  • Pay-less · 5 days before final
  • Practical completion certificate
// Form 04

Domestic / day work

  • Day work sheets · signed on phone
  • Variation orders · client-signed PDF
  • Domestic Building Contracts (FMB)
  • Cost-plus and fixed-price quotes
  • Retention · 5% standard, configurable
  • Final account · one click

04How do you handle drawing revisions safely?+
Every drawing carries its revision and a distribution log. When a new revision is issued, the system supersedes the previous one on every device that downloaded it, sends a phone notification to operatives still on the old revision, and re-binds open snags to the new coordinates where possible. The previous revisions stay archived for the audit trail.
